That's something that's missing in the Boozer discussion. Let's look as this logically...

If we start from the premise that Boozer is going to skip town to Miami, and that's why the Jazz need to trade him, then why would any NBA team give us fair value for him? For instance, why would the Bobcats serve up Okafor for Boozer? Our trading Carlos would basically be proof that he's opting out for Miami. Thus, it would be clear to Charlotte that Booz was only theirs for a single year. Why would they do the trade then?
